Mike Disfarmer

Mike Disfarmer was an American photographer (1884–1959). He was born at Portersville and died at Heber Springs.

Also recorded as Michael Meyer; Michael Disfarmer; Mike Meyer Disfarmer.

Recognition and collections

Work by Mike Disfarmer is held by Museum of Modern Art, Harry Ransom Center, Michael C. Carlos Museum and San Francisco Museum of Modern Art.
